I had an unusual one tonight. I have a Windows XP VM decide that the hardware had to many changes in the last 30 days and wanted to re-register with Microsoft. This is a built in XP feature that is supposed to prevent swapping the disk to a new system with out buying a new license. The catch is the system was built and registered as a VM and the only hardware change was a reduction in memory and that was done weeks ago. Has anyone else run into this? If possible I would like to avoid this in the future. My solution was based on a large hard disk that hosts the original VMs so I keep the original of a VM safe and work with a clone. ( I love clones). In short I pulled off the data I needed, deleted the wayward VM and cloned the original. Updated the antivirus and windows updates on the clone, installed the data and I'm back in buisness. I did loose am hour of productinve time doing the updates and installs though.
